A Brief History of Robotic Vacuum Cleaners
The journey of robotic vacuum cleaners started in the late 20th century, with early models stopping working to make significant strides in homes. However, developments in technology caused the intro of more refined designs in the early 2000s. Business such as iRobot and Neato played an essential function in popularizing these smart home devices.
Evolution Timeline of Robotic Vacuum Cleaners
Year
Turning point
1996
Introduce of the very first robotic vacuum, the ELECTROLUX TRINITY
2002
iRobot presents the Roomba, a widely acknowledged model
2012
Intro of designs with innovative mapping capabilities
2020
Incorporation of synthetic intelligence for improved navigation
2023
Designs with integrated smart home connectivity and app control
How Robotic Vacuum Cleaners Work
Robotic vacuum utilize a mix of sensing units, mapping technology, and synthetic intelligence to navigate and tidy different surfaces efficiently. Here's a streamlined introduction of their core performance:
Sensors: Equipped with infrared or ultrasonic sensing units, these devices can detect obstacles, cliffs, and dirt, allowing them to browse through rooms without crashing into furniture or toppling down stairs.
Navigation: Most modern-day robotic vacuum cleaners include clever mapping technologies, permitting them to map out the home layout and enhance cleaning courses.
Cleaning Mechanism: Using brushes and suction power, robotic vacuums collect dirt, dust, and debris from numerous floor types, consisting of carpets and wood.
Charging and Cleaning Schedules: After completing a cleaning session or when their battery runs low, these robotics immediately return to their charging dock. Users can set cleaning schedules through smart device apps, helping keep a neat home easily.

Factors to consider Before Purchasing a Robotic Vacuum Cleaner
While robotic vacuum cleaners use numerous benefits, possible purchasers must think about a few factors before buying. Here are some points to bear in mind:
Key Factors to Evaluate
Floor Type: Certain models carry out better on carpets while others excel on difficult floorings. robotic vacuum cleaner UK should pick flexible vacuums if they have actually blended floor covering.
Battery Life: Longer battery life permits for extended cleaning sessions. Look for models that can cover big areas without regular recharging.
Dustbin Capacity: A larger dustbin reduces the frequency of clearing, making cleaning less labor-intensive.
Sound Level: Some models operate silently, which is best for homes with babies or delicate animals.
Upkeep: Users should also evaluate the ease of upkeep, specifically for filters and brushes.
Possible Drawbacks
- Price: Robotic vacuum cleaners can be considerably more expensive than conventional vacuums.
- Efficiency: While they effectively keep tidiness, they may not always match the deep cleaning effectiveness of manual vacuums.
- Obstacle Navigation: Some models may struggle with certain types of furniture or cluttered areas, possibly resulting in missed out on areas.
